Withdraw notification for evictions: Krishna Iyer
Special Correspondent
THIRUVANANTHAPURAM: The former judge of the Supreme Court V.R. Krishna Iyer wrote to Chief Minister V.S. Achuthanandan on Sunday demanding withdrawal of the notification for eviction of large number of people for the Vizhinjam International Transhipment Project.
Mr. Iyer noted in his letter that 1,098 hectares had been notified for eviction. This would mean eviction of about 6,000 families. Even if only 227 families were to be evicted as had been stated by the Chief Minister, it should be done only after making arrangements for their rehabilitation. “All moves for evictions without completing arrangements for rehabilitation should be abandoned.”
While development was welcome, it would cause more harm than good if development caused loss of habitat and hardships to a section of the populace, he added.
